Job Description

Location: Alabang, Muntinlupa | Work Arrangement: Full Onsite

About the Role

We are looking for an Internal Audit Manager / Senior Internal Audit Officer (Individual Contributor to Manager) to serve as a key partner in strengthening risk management, internal controls, governance, and operational efficiency across a diverse portfolio of businesses.

This role goes beyond traditional compliance-focused auditing. The successful candidate will be expected to understand how the business operates, identify risks and process gaps, and work collaboratively with management to develop practical solutions that protect enterprise value and support sustainable growth.

The role offers exposure to multiple industries, including Real Estate, Mining, and related businesses.

Key Responsibilities

  • Plan and conduct operational, financial, and compliance audits across various business units and subsidiaries.
  • Assess internal controls, risk management processes, governance frameworks, and operational workflows.
  • Identify control gaps, process inefficiencies, potential financial leakage, and other business risks.
  • Conduct root-cause analysis and work with process owners to develop practical and sustainable corrective actions.
  • Partner with business leaders and management teams to improve processes while maintaining effective risk controls.
  • Prepare clear and actionable audit reports and present findings to key stakeholders.
  • Monitor the implementation of audit recommendations and provide updates to management.
  • Contribute to the development of a risk-based Internal Audit Plan and identify opportunities to strengthen governance and standardize best practices across the organization.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Accountancy, Finance, or a related field.
  • 5–7 years of relevant audit experience, with a combination of external and internal/operational audit experience preferred.
  • Experience in external audit or Big 4/public accounting firms is an advantage.
  • Exposure to Real Estate, Mining, Shipping/Tankering, Logistics, or related industries is highly advantageous.
  • Experience in a holding company, conglomerate, or multi-entity organization is strongly preferred.
  • Strong understanding of internal controls, risk management, financial processes, and audit methodologies.
  • Excellent analytical, communication, and stakeholder management skills.
  • Ability to work independently and manage the full audit cycle, from planning and fieldwork to reporting and follow-through.
  • CPA, CIA, or other relevant professional certifications are an advantage but not required.
